About Cherrybrook 2126

The size of Cherrybrook is approximately 8.3 square kilometres. It has 30 parks covering nearly 49.8% of total area. The population of Cherrybrook in 2011 was 18,779 people. By 2016 the population was 18,743 showing a population decline of 0.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cherrybrook is 10-19 years. Households in Cherrybrook are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cherrybrook work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 86.1% of the homes in Cherrybrook were owner-occupied compared with 83.4% in 2016.

Cherrybrook has 6,575 properties.
